What Do Chief Commercial Officers Do?
- Analyze industry activity to develop business plans and create meaningful KPIs.
- Provide revenue and financial support to the executive team.
- Manage sales/commercial team while motivating, driving and developing talent.
- Implement and maintain sales process to achieve sales objectives.

How can Chief Commercial Officers increase their salary?
Increasing your pay as a Chief Commercial Officer is possible in different ways. Change of employer: Consider a career move to a new employer that is willing to pay higher for your skills. Level of Education: Gaining advanced degrees may allow this role to increase their income potential and qualify for promotions. Managing Experience: If you are a Chief Commercial Officer that oversees more junior Chief Commercial Officers, this experience can increase the likelihood to earn more.
